National Testing Agency (NTA) has released the Result for Navayug School Sarojini Nagar Entrance Test (NSSNET) 2026. Candidates who appeared in the entrance examination for admission into Class 6th and Class 7th can now check and download their result online.NSSNET is conducted for admission into Navayug School Sarojini Nagar, New Delhi. Candidates qualifying the entrance examination will be considered for admission according to merit and eligibility conditions.Students and parents are advised to carefully check the result notice and further admission instructions available on the official website.
Navayug School Sarojini Nagar Entrance Test (NSSNET) is conducted by National Testing Agency (NTA) for admission into Class VI and VII in Navayug School Sarojini Nagar, New Delhi.
The school provides quality education facilities and admission is offered through a competitive entrance examination process.

There was no application fee for NSSNET 2026 registration and admission process.
- For Class 6th : Age Between 10 and 12 Years as on 31 March 2026.
- For Class 7th : Age Between 11 and 13 Years as on 31 March 2026.
- Read detailed age eligibility in official notification.
| Class | Total Seats | Eligibility Details |
|---|---|---|
| Class 6th (VI) | 105 | Age between 10-12 Years and minimum qualifying marks required. |
| Class 7th (VII) | 58 | Age between 11-13 Years and minimum qualifying marks required. |
Candidates must secure minimum 65% aggregate marks and 50% marks in each subject in NSSNET examination.
